Azou wrote:Tony is I guess what one would call "visible talent," so firing Tony is a big move. Putting forth my best twisted atheist bunker minion analysis here (you seem bitter, Tony), I wager:
A) They really did lay him off, and LW is in a bad spot. It's possible that Tony wasn't seen as super important, and his salary was just a large chunk of money they could take back. But generally, you quietly fire off backward people first as opposed to very publically showing how badly you need money.
B) Maybe they are hurting, money-wise, but not enough to need to fire Tony. Perhaps they intended to make a very public spectacle out of their financial need in order to drum up some sale/donations. Ray's shrewd enough to throw Tony overboard for this.
C) Tony has a history of getting in arguments with supposed allies. Things that LW prefers to keep quiet about, like their Calvinism. Maybe he went too far.
D) Tony is just a crazy guy with a downright scary need for authority. Maybe they saw him as PR poison?

Requirements and Responsibilities
What are the requirements and responsibilities for a church wishing to schedule Ray for a speaking engagement? You'll find those details below...
Requirements for Churches in Southern California
(By "Churches in Southern California," we mean Churches that are within a 1 hour driving distance from L.A.)
We do not charge a fee, but a "love offering" is requested
The church must allow Living Waters to set-up a book table
There must be a minimum of 60 people in attendance
Requirements for Churches in Other Locations
We do not charge a fee, but a "love offering" is requested
The church must allow Living Waters to set-up a book table
Two round-trip airline tickets from LAX (preferably a direct flight--this is very important)
Hotel accommodations for two people (one room, two beds)
If you want to schedule Ray, then there must be a minimum of 1000 people in attendance. (To schedule another staff member there need only be 200 people in attendance... see below.)
